NRWA's Revolving Loan Fund Available for a Limited Time
The NRWA Revolving Loan Fund was established under a grant from USDA / RUS to
provide financing to eligible utilities for pre-development costs associated
with proposed water an wastewater projects. RLF funds can also be used
with existing water / wastewater systems and the short term costs incurred for
replacement equipment, small scale extension services or other small capital
projects that are not a part of your regular operations and maintenance.
Please visit their website at www.nrwarlf.org
for more details.

Recall Notice Sherwood
recommends valves of the 1209,1210,1211,1214,and 1214F series with date codes EK,
FK, GK, HK, KK, and LK be removed from service and returned. The date code
designations appear on the lower right corner of the valve marking. Only these
series and date code valves are to be returned for replacement.
Report the valves
which you require replacement at
www.sherwoodvalve.com/chlorine_valve_reporting.htm For return
authorization and replacement information please contact customer service for
Sherwood at 888-508-2583 or by fax at 800-416-0678.
